Why do specialists invest so much time recognizing themselves? Because therapy sessions are often emotional rollercoaster experiences. When specialists understand their history and feelings, they have a safety and security belt on that rollercoaster and are able to stay concentrated in sessions.


These sensations most commonly spring from an individual's background. Transference sensations in session are frequently forecasts from patients' backgrounds.

Goal countertransference refers to the therapist's sensations toward the client based upon the therapist's reaction to the person's transference. If a client does not rely on the specialist, a poorly trained or new specialist might take it personally and persuade the individual to trust them. This often backfires and intensifies resistance to depend on.


(https://many-parts-therapy.jimdosite.com)Transference Crucial Reads Like objective countertransference, subjective countertransference also refers to the specialist's sensations towards the client. If the specialist has a childhood background of misuse, a violent client may trigger the specialist's injury.




They might locate a method to stop functioning with the client or avoid confronting them out of anxiety of revenge. In specific sessions, specialists navigate the three degrees of sensations - transfer, countertransference, and subjective transfer - by frequently processing and assessing their sensations. "Where is this feeling coming from? Is it the patient's transference? Or is it my subjective or unbiased countertransference?" Group therapists manage multiple transfers.

A specialist for psychological health is a qualified specialist who works very closely with clients to develop better emotional and cognitive abilities, simplicity symptoms of mental disorder and learn vital coping skills to enhance quality of life


The daily obligations of a therapist vary from one person to another, yet generally, psychological wellness therapists talk with their customers concerning any signs they may be experiencing, go over options for dealing with mental health and wellness signs and diagnose mental disorders. In order to aid people dealing with their mental well-being, specialists use talk treatment to pay attention to any kind of issues or issues a client has while supplying services that the specialist and customer deal with together.

As a whole, the term "specialist" is comprehensive and describes psycho therapists, therapists and counselors. When referring to a specialist who deals with a client to improve his/her mental wellness, specialist and therapist may be utilized reciprocally.


A therapist usually has a bit much less education and learning or training yet is still required to be certified to practice. A counselor might concentrate on a specific location, such as marriage counselling, to offer those seeking to boost their marriage or domestic partnerships. A therapist may have a higher degree of education and learning than a counselor, probably even a doctorate level.
